Maps Software Engineer - Scala/Spark

Malmo, Skane, Sweden
Software and Services


Weekly Hours: 40
Role Number:200169161
We, the Maps Data team are responsible for the platform and systems to represent a wide variety of map features for the entire globe! In this role the successful candidate will bridge the software engineering team and the users to optimize the usage and benefits from the software systems and will get to work with some of the latest and greatest platforms and frameworks!

Key Qualifications

  • - MS in computer science or equivalent.
  • - 3+ years developing distributed data processing pipelines for sophisticated data sets.
  • - 5+ years Object-oriented/functional programming and design skills, preferably in Scala.
  • - Shown deep proficiency with Big Data processing technologies
  • - Experience designing or implementing systems which work with external vendors' interfaces
  • - Ability to wear different hats and a can a problem solving mind set.


We're responsible for building data validation platforms that are used at scale. You will be mostly coding in Scala and working with Play Framework, Spark, Mongo DB and Akka and more. Maps is a complex product and you'll be challenged in your ability to grasp things quickly and working fast with smart people. Successful candidates will have strong engineering skills and communication, as well as a belief that collaborative development builds a better product and make you a better engineer.

Education & Experience

MS in computer science or equivalent.

Additional Requirements

  • - Geo spatial experience
  • - Proficiency with Play or other similar Frameworks is a nice bonus
  • - Experience with Jenkins or other build-integration systems
  • - Hands-on experience from Hadoop technologies like MR, Spark, Yarn etc.
  • - Experience using and operating Mongo and PostGres.
  • - Experience with reactive programming.
  • Apple is an Equal Opportunity Employer that is committed to inclusion and diversity. We also take affirmative action to offer employment and advancement opportunities to all applicants, including minorities, women, protected veterans, and individuals with disabilities. Apple will not discriminate or retaliate against applicants who inquire about, disclose, or discuss their compensation or that of other applicants.